Analysis

Philippines recorded 20 for number of isolates tested for azithromycin in 2020. That is the lowest value across all 7 years on record.

The figure is down 58.3% on the previous year and down 77.5% over ten years.

That places Philippines 42nd out of 47 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the bottom quarter.
